#5e1572 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5e1572 is composed of 36.9% red, 8.2% green and 44.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 17.5% cyan, 81.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 55.3% black. It has a hue angle of 287.1 degrees, a saturation of 68.9% and a lightness of 26.5%. #5e1572 color hex could be obtained by blending #bc2ae4 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660066.

Shades and Tints of #5e1572

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c030f is the darkest color, while #fefdff is the lightest one.
